Pasco Hernando State College
Bachelor of Applied Science Degree Supervision and Management
- New Port Richey, USA
Bachelor's degree
On-Campus
English
The Bachelor of Applied Science in Supervision and Management (BAS-SM) program is designed to prepare graduates for supervisory and management roles in a variety of organizational settings. The BAS-SM program uses a 2+2 model that requires applicants to have completed an associate's degree or equivalent for entry into the program. The program is tailored to meet the needs of a diverse student population in the community, including flexible scheduling, face-to-face, and online classes, and the ability to complete the program as either a part-time or full-time student.

Lenoir-Rhyne University
Bachelor of Science Business Administration
- Hickory, USA
BSc
On-Campus
English
Earn your degree in business administration and move your education and career forward… without putting your life on hold. Available only to Adult Learner students, the Business Administration (BSBA) major is designed to provide adult learners with a general business degree and/or prepare them for completion of an MBA degree at Lenoir-Rhyne. The major recognizes the value of significant life experiences of adult students their motivation; and delicate balance of work, education, and family expectations. The BSBA hybrid classes are offered on Monday evenings only and are designed so that students may take four courses each semester; however, other courses to fulfill the core may require other class arrangements.
